where the pilot is open
open now to women 18 and older who live in these states: washington, virginia, new york, texas, new jersey, delaware, florida, indiana, and idaho.
you don't have to stay put all summer. your care (visits, prescriptions, and labs) just needs to happen while you're in an eligible state.
what's expected of you
pilot members share ongoing feedback through surveys and focus groups. it's a condition of the no-cost services.
prescriptions, labs & costs
visits and messaging are at no cost during the pilot. for prescriptions and labs, you can use insurance if applicable or pay out of pocket. standard pharmacy and lab fees may apply.
